This position is for a Senior Business Analyst within a Public Pension organization, where the selected candidate will play a pivotal role in bridging the gap between business stakeholders and technical teams. The core responsibilities include leading requirements elicitation and documentation efforts, crafting comprehensive test plans, and facilitating effective communication across departments. Candidates must possess at least (5) five years of experience in business analysis , specifically in requirements gathering, documentation, and quality assurance or testing. Expertise in the Public Pension System domain is essential, as the role demands familiarity with its unique functionalities and processes. Additionally, the Senior Business Analyst will be expected to conduct Joint Application Development (JAD) sessions with product owners and business users to address complex business needs. Collaboration with the development team will be crucial for designing tailored solutions, developing and executing business function test cases, and assisting in the triage and testing of defects during User Acceptance Testing (UAT).
